What Are Tata Structural Pipes?
Understanding High-Performance Structural Steel Solutions
Tata Structural Pipes are precision-engineered hollow steel sections manufactured for structural applications requiring exceptional strength, durability, and dimensional accuracy.
These pipes are widely used across numerous construction sectors, including:
- Industrial buildings
- Warehouses
- Commercial complexes
- Multi-storey buildings
- Factory sheds
- Pre-Engineered Buildings (PEBs)
- Infrastructure projects
- Bridges
- Educational institutions
- Healthcare facilities
Their excellent strength-to-weight ratio makes them one of the most efficient structural materials available for sustainable construction.

H3: High Strength with Reduced Material Usage
One of the biggest advantages of Tata Structural Pipes is their excellent strength-to-weight ratio.
Unlike conventional construction materials that often require larger quantities to achieve the same structural performance, high-strength structural steel pipes provide greater load-bearing capacity with optimized material usage.
Benefits include:
- Lower overall steel consumption
- Reduced structural dead load
- Efficient foundation design
- Lower transportation costs
- Improved construction efficiency
Using less material without compromising structural integrity supports sustainable building practices while reducing overall project costs.

H2: Prevention Tips
Proper handling and maintenance can significantly extend the service life of structural steel components.
Best practices include:
- Conduct regular structural inspections.
- Apply protective coatings where required.
- Prevent prolonged exposure to standing water.
- Follow recommended fabrication and welding procedures.
- Address minor corrosion before it spreads.
- Store steel materials correctly before installation.
- Schedule periodic maintenance for industrial facilities.
Preventive care reduces repair costs and preserves structural integrity over time.
